Walk into many older buildings, and you'll notice a common theme: walls that feel heavy, both visually and literally. For decades, architects and contractors have relied on natural stone—marble, granite, traditional travertine—to bring elegance to interiors and exteriors. But behind that beauty lies a host of challenges that often go unseen until construction begins.
Consider the weight: a single square meter of natural travertine can weigh upwards of 25 kilograms. Multiply that by the walls of a high-rise hotel or a sprawling commercial complex, and you're looking at structural stress that requires reinforced framing, thicker foundations, and higher engineering costs. Then there's installation: traditional stone tiles are brittle, meaning they crack easily during transport, and cutting them to fit unique spaces demands specialized tools and skilled labor. By the time the project wraps up, timelines have stretched, budgets have ballooned, and the environmental impact—from quarrying to waste—lingers long after the last tile is laid.
And yet, we keep choosing stone. Why? Because nothing else captures that timeless, organic texture—the way light plays off its pores, the depth of its color variations, the sense of permanence it brings to a space.
